Summary

Quartz exposure decreases cyclin D1 and cyclin-dependent kinase 4 (CDK4) protein levels in lung fibroblasts. Extracellular signal-regulated kinases (ERKs) and c-Jun N-terminal kinases (JNKs) mediate this effect via the AP-1 pathway.

The orderly progression of the cell cycle depends on the activation of Cdk protein by binding to its cyclin partner. However, the cell cycle must be restricted when undergoing abnormal changes. Most cancers correlate to the deregulated cell cycle, and since Cdks are a central component of the cell cycle, Cdk inhibitors are extensively studied to develop anticancer agents. Several external and internal factors influence the initiation and inhibition of cell division. For instance, the death of nearby cells or the release of human growth hormone (hGH) promotes cell division. In contrast, lack of hGH or crowding of cells can inhibit cell division.
